Thyroglobulin Antibody (1D4) is a mouse monoclonal IgG2a antibody that detects thyroglobulin in human samples through various applications including western blotting (WB), immunoprecipitation (IP), immunofluorescence (IF), immunohistochemistry with paraffin-embedded sections (IHCP), and enzyme-linked immunosorbent assay (ELISA). Thyroglobulin is a crucial protein synthesized in the thyroid gland, serving as the precursor for the iodinated thyroid hormones thyroxine and triiodothyronine, which are essential for regulating metabolism, growth, and development. Anti-thyroglobulin antibody (1D4) enables researchers to study post-translational modifications, including glycosylation, which are necessary for thyroglobulin stability and activity. These modifications facilitate correct folding and maturation of thyroglobulin while playing a significant role in secretion and subsequent hormone synthesis. Disruptions in these processes can lead to conditions such as goiter, characterized by thyroid gland enlargement, often resulting from defective dimerization and transport of thyroglobulin to the Golgi complex. Thyroglobulin monoclonal antibody (1D4) serves as an invaluable tool for researchers studying thyroid function and related disorders, providing insights into molecular mechanisms underlying thyroid hormone synthesis and regulation.

Can Thyroglobulin (1D4): sc-53543 monoclonal antibody be used to stain formalin-fixed, paraffin-embedded (FFPE) tissue sections?

Asked by: jerojero
Thank you for your question. Yes, Thyroglobulin (1D4): sc-53543 has been validated for use in IHC with paraffin-embedded sections. We recommend performing antigen retrieval with sodium citrate buffer (pH 6) and heat. The full protocol can be found here: https://www.scbt.com/scbt/resources/protocols/immunoperoxidase-staining
